Sri Ramakrishna Hospital in Coimbatore performed a life-saving procedure on a 15-day-old newborn suffering from critical aortic stenosis. The emergency balloon aortic valvotomy was executed with precision, saving the life of the baby born to a migrant worker family from Aurangabad.

The hospital's skilled pediatric cardiac team diagnosed the severe condition that endangered the child's life. The timely intervention was a collaborative effort by neonatologists, pediatric cardiologists, and cardiac surgeons, showcasing their expertise in high-risk neonatal care.

This remarkable operation, supported by medical sponsorship, underscores the importance of humanitarian efforts in healthcare. Sri Ramakrishna Hospital's commitment to excellence in pediatric cardiac care continues to provide hope and advanced treatment options to families in need.
